Kitten dies after being thrown over garden fence as RSPCA releases chilling video

A kitten has died after being thrown over a garden fence, with the RSPCA releasing chilling footage in a bid to find those responsible.

CCTV video captures the distressing moment a kitten falls out of the sky and crashes into a patio slab - as a loud thump is then heard.

The black and white video, which was captured by a back garden wildlife camera, shows the distressed kitten rolling around in pain before the video fades to black.

The ginger kitten, which is thought to have been just a few weeks old, was found in the garden of a home in Southampton.

RSPCA Animal rescue officer, Karen Gregor, who is investigating the incident, said: "This was a shocking and senseless act of deliberate cruelty towards a defenceless animal who sadly lost its life as a result.

"The resident discovered the tiny kitten's body in their garden the following morning and watched through the footage to find out how and when the kitten had come to be there.

"The footage shows the kitten coming very quickly into shot from over the fence, before hitting the hard pathway.

"Heartbreakingly, the kitten can then be seen struggling and kicking after hitting the floor."

She added: "We really need help to identify whoever is responsible and we're asking anyone with information to contact the RSPCA Inspector appeal line on 0300 123 8018."

Figures released in 2021 by the RSPCA show that over the past five years there have been 14,825 recorded incidents of deliberate cruelty towards cats.

Which means an average of four cats being deliberately harmed every single day across England and Wales.
